The "missing 8 minutes" is actually accounted for by the end credits. The official running time for a movie always includes the end credits. Starting sometime in the 1970s, movies began to include "everything but the kitchen sink" end credits that named virtually everyone who played even a minute part in making a movie; as a result, the official running times became longer than the length of the movie itself.Jazz Girl wrote: They won't release an official time until the editing is complete and special FX are complete.
